Rooted

Large trees are deeply rooted.  This rootedness takes time, it is very slow, can't be sped up, so growth is slow, yet in the end you get a glorious tree with luxuriant foliage, giving shade and coolness in the summer, often living depending on the species for centuries.

I think people grow like trees when it comes to answering the call.   It takes time for our true roots to grow deeply in the soil, with perhaps many mistakes and bad turns along the way.  Yet the call felt deep within, still leads us onwards, zig- zagging perhaps, but not so far off the road that some direction can still be discerned. 

The chaos along the way and yes the failures can be a help on our journey, if the enemy is not given into to.  What is the enemy?  It is despairing of ever making real progress.   The problem with that kind of thinking is it is based on a lie.   In the end progress is a mystery, for amidst the failures and chaos, if the heart is kept open, one day we seem to arrive at a ‘certain place' that was thought impossible.  So it is the hidden workings of grace, bringing order out of inner chaos and failures, were true progress is made.

It is love at work, we call it grace.   All we need do is keep open, stay on the road, if abandoned, well to get back on again.   The number of times one fails does not matter, for mercy, the kind of mercy that pursues us, is infinite.  Our mishaps are woven in the tapestry of our lives, it is what gives it depth and beauty.

Joy comes from knowing that simple ‘thing'.  We are loved, simple to say but hard to believe.  The revelation of Jesus is true, yet the closer one comes to that mystery the harder it can be to believe.  At least that is my experience.   So I have to choose to believe and dive in deeper.  My faith is a choice, though the roots are fed by the water of grace, the deep well of God with us. 

God loves all.   The mercy shown me is the same mercy that is shown to all.  So an open heart, filled with joy and the love of others is our road and no amount of failure will change that.   We are all called.  Some answer early, others later much later.   Yes we are loved, on a journey and united in ways that we can neither know nor understand at this time.
